Colleen Lamos re-evaluates central texts of the modernist canon by T. S. Eliot, James Joyce and Marcel Proust, examining sexual energies and identifications in them that are typically regarded as perverse. She offers a stimulating reconsideration of modernist literature, gender categories and the relation between errant sexuality and literary 'mistakes'.
